/[smecontribs]/rpms/smeserver-smeadmin/contribs10/smeserver-smeadmin.spec
ViewVC logotype

Diff of /rpms/smeserver-smeadmin/contribs10/smeserver-smeadmin.spec

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ph | View Patch Patch

Revision 1.1 by jcrisp, Wed Oct 28 16:52:20 2020 UTC Revision 1.13 by jpp, Fri Nov 11 16:19:44 2022 UTC
# Line 7  Summary: A graphical monitor, alert rais Line 7  Summary: A graphical monitor, alert rais
7  %define name smeserver-smeadmin  %define name smeserver-smeadmin
8  Name: %{name}  Name: %{name}
9  %define version 1.6  %define version 1.6
10  %define release 1  %define release 10
11  Version: %{version}  Version: %{version}
12  Release: %{release}%{?dist}  Release: %{release}%{?dist}
13  License: GPL  License: GPL
14  Group: Networking/Daemons  Group: Networking/Daemons
15  Source: %{name}-%{version}.tar.gz  Source: %{name}-%{version}.tar.gz
16    Patch0: smeserver-smeadmin-1.6-bz11062-initial-import.patch
17    Patch1: smeserver-smeadmin-1.6-locale-2021-08-24.patch
18    Patch2: smeserver-smeadmin-1.6-locale-2021-09-08.patch
19    Patch3: smeserver-smeadmin-1.6-bz10761_real_ssh_port.patch
20    Patch4: smeserver-smeadmin-1.6-bz11642-bz1159-authproxy-errorlog.patch
21    Patch5: smeserver-smeadmin-1.6-locale-2022-07-29.patch
22    Patch6: smeserver-smeadmin-1.6-bz12023-backup.patch
23    Patch7: smeserver-smeadmin-1.6-bz11643-services.patch
24    Patch8: smeserver-smeadmin-1.6-locale-2022-11-11.patch
25    
26  BuildRoot: /var/tmp/%{name}-%{version}-%{release}-buildroot  BuildRoot: /var/tmp/%{name}-%{version}-%{release}-buildroot
27  BuildArchitectures: noarch  BuildArchitectures: noarch
# Line 32  Requires: lm_sensors Line 41  Requires: lm_sensors
41  AutoReqProv: no  AutoReqProv: no
42    
43  %changelog  %changelog
44    * Fri Nov 11 2022 Jean-Philippe Pialasse <tests@pialasse.com> 1.6-10.sme
45    - apply locale 2022-11-11 patch
46    
47    * Sun Sep 18 2022 Jean-Philippe Pialasse <tests@pialasse.com> 1.6-9.sme
48    - fix misisng stopped services [SME: 11643]
49    
50    * Sat Jul 30 2022 Brian Read <brianr@bjsystems.co.uk> 1.6-8.sme
51    - Re-build and link to latest devtools [SME: 11997]
52    
53    * Fri Jul 29 2022 Jean-Philippe Pialasse <tests@pialasse.com> 1.6-7.sme
54    - apply translation 2022-07-29
55    - add to core backup [SME: 12023]
56    
57    * Mon Jul 18 2022 zsolt vasarhelyi <vasarhelyizsolt@hotmail.com> 1.6-6.sme
58    - bz11642 authproxy errorlog [SME: 11642]
59    - bz11590 error log [SME: 11590]
60    
61    * Mon Jul 18 2022 Michel Begue <mab974@misouk.com> 1.6-5.sme
62    - get real ssh port from configuration db. [SME: 10761]
63    
64    * Wed Sep 08 2021 Terry Fage <terry.fage@gmail.com> 1.6-4.sme
65    - apply locale 2021-09-08 patch
66    
67    * Tue Aug 24 2021 Terry Fage <terry.fage@gmail.com> 1.6-3.sme
68    - apply locale 2021-08-24 patch
69    
70    * Thu Mar 25 2021 Jean-Philippe Pialasse <tests@pialasse.com> 1.6-2.sme
71    - Re-build and link to latest devtools mysql not migrating sme9admind  [SME: 11062]
72    - Re-build and link to latest devtools config db sme9admind not migrated to smeadmind
73    - Re-build and link to latest devtools /var/lib/sme9admin not migrated
74    - add smeserver-smeadmin-update event
75    - Re-build and link to latest devtools services diplayed multiple times [SME: 11455]
76    - systemd unit
77    - review new logs locations
78    - check calls to sysvinit
79    - TODO implement new VPNs stats
80    
81  * Thu Oct 15 2020 Brian Read <brianr@bjsystems.co.uk> 1.6-1  * Thu Oct 15 2020 Brian Read <brianr@bjsystems.co.uk> 1.6-1
82  - Move to SME10, rename to smeadmin [SME: 11040]  - Move to SME10, rename to smeadmin [SME: 11040, 11062]
83    
84  * Sat Dec 07 2019 SME Translation Server <translations@contribs.org> 1.5-30.sme  * Sat Dec 07 2019 SME Translation Server <translations@contribs.org> 1.5-30.sme
85  - apply locale 2019-12-07 patch  - apply locale 2019-12-07 patch
86    
87  * Mon Sep 09 2019 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-29.sme  * Mon Sep 09 2019 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-29.sme
88  - fix smeadmind die on mysql connection error [SME: 7683]  - Re-build and link to latest devtools smeadmind die on mysql connection error [SME: 7683]
89    
90  * Sat Dec 02 2017 SME Translation Server <translations@contribs.org> 1.5-28.sme  * Sat Dec 02 2017 SME Translation Server <translations@contribs.org> 1.5-28.sme
91  - apply locale 2017-12-02 patch  - apply locale 2017-12-02 patch
92    
93  * Mon Aug 14 2017 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-27.sme  * Mon Aug 14 2017 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-27.sme
94  - add support for altqmail [SME: 10409]  - add support for altqmail [SME: 10409]
95    
96  * Mon Jul 10 2017 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-26.sme  * Mon Jul 10 2017 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-26.sme
97  - fix error after migrating sme8admin db, unable to access mysql db [SME: 10181]  - Re-build and link to latest devtools error after migrating sme8admin db, unable to access mysql db [SME: 10181]
98    
99  * Sat Mar 25 2017 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-25.sme  * Sat Mar 25 2017 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-25.sme
100  - apply locale 2017-03-26 patch  - apply locale 2017-03-26 patch
101    
102  * Wed Feb 01 2017 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-24.sme  * Wed Feb 01 2017 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-24.sme
103  - apply locale 2017-02-02.patch  - apply locale 2017-02-02.patch
104    
105  * Sun Jan 01 2017 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-23.sme  * Sun Jan 01 2017 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-23.sme
106  - fix warning related to raid detection code [SME: 9886]  - Re-build and link to latest devtools warning related to raid detection code [SME: 9886]
107  - fix warning related to non existing services removed sinces previous versions [SME: 9889]  - Re-build and link to latest devtools warning related to non existing services removed sinces previous versions [SME: 9889]
108    
109  * Tue Dec 20 2016 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-22.sme  * Tue Dec 20 2016 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-22.sme
110  - make CGI and pictures utf8 compliant [SME: 9894]  - make CGI and pictures utf8 compliant [SME: 9894]
111  - apply smeserver-smeadmin-1.5-locale-2016-12-20.patch  - apply smeserver-smeadmin-1.5-locale-2016-12-20.patch
112    
113  * Sat Dec 17 2016 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-21.sme  * Sat Dec 17 2016 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-21.sme
114  - locals smeserver-smeadmin-1.5-locale-2016-12-18.patch  - locals smeserver-smeadmin-1.5-locale-2016-12-18.patch
115    
116  * Sat Dec 17 2016 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-20.sme  * Sat Dec 17 2016 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-20.sme
117  - fix last patch by adding path to called programs  - Re-build and link to latest devtools last patch by adding path to called programs
118    
119  * Thu Dec 15 2016 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-19.sme  * Thu Dec 15 2016 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-19.sme
120  - fix bad accounting for incoming and outgoing mail [SME: 8818]  - Re-build and link to latest devtools bad accounting for incoming and outgoing mail [SME: 8818]
121  - mail_in alert now account for all queued emails from qpsmtpd and sqpsmtpd  - mail_in alert now account for all queued emails from qpsmtpd and sqpsmtpd
122  - mail_out alert now account for qmail total remote delivery attempts  - mail_out alert now account for qmail total remote delivery attempts
123  - known issue : on first run will account more than 5 minutes ( whole log) and will alert for exceeding amount  - known issue : on first run will account more than 5 minutes ( whole log) and will alert for exceeding amount
124  - added accounting of qpsmtpd and sqpsmtpd code  - added accounting of qpsmtpd and sqpsmtpd code
125  - TODO: alert on qmail queue too high, alert on too many qpsmtpd connections  - TODO: alert on qmail queue too high, alert on too many qpsmtpd connections
126    
127  * Wed Nov 23 2016 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-18.sme  * Wed Nov 23 2016 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-18.sme
128  - fix limited size in mysql fields for traffic accounting [SME: 8399]  - Re-build and link to latest devtools limited size in mysql fields for traffic accounting [SME: 8399]
129    
130  * Wed Nov 23 2016 Jean-Philipe Pialasse <tests@pialasse.com> 1.5-16.sme  * Wed Nov 23 2016 Jean-Philippe Pialasse <tests@pialasse.com> 1.5-16.sme
131  - add more verbose email alert [SME: 9725]  - add more verbose email alert [SME: 9725]
132    
133  * Fri Aug 21 2015 stephane de Labrusse <stephdl@de-labrusse.fr> 1.5-15.sme  * Fri Aug 21 2015 stephane de Labrusse <stephdl@de-labrusse.fr> 1.5-15.sme
# Line 121  AutoReqProv: no Line 167  AutoReqProv: no
167  * Wed Jun 18 2014 stephane de labrusse <stephdl@de-labrusse.fr> 1.5-6.sme  * Wed Jun 18 2014 stephane de labrusse <stephdl@de-labrusse.fr> 1.5-6.sme
168  - Initial release to sme9  - Initial release to sme9
169    
170  * Sun Dec 15 2013 JP Pialasse <test@pialasse.com> 1.3-4.sme  * Sun Dec 15 2013 Jean-Philippe Pialasse <tests@pialasse.com> 1.3-4.sme
171  - fix obsolete missing [SME: 7109]  - Re-build and link to latest devtools obsolete missing [SME: 7109]
172  - fix pppoe and vpn loging [SME: 8061]  - Re-build and link to latest devtools pppoe and vpn loging [SME: 8061]
173  - added monthly ppoe log    - added monthly ppoe log  
174  - fix stop on mysql error too many connections [SME: 7683]    - Re-build and link to latest devtools stop on mysql error too many connections [SME: 7683]  
175    
176  * Sun Sep 09 2012 JP Pialasse <test@pialasse.com> 1.3-3.sme  * Sun Sep 09 2012 Jean-Philippe Pialasse <tests@pialasse.com> 1.3-3.sme
177  - startup fix [SME 3022]  - startup fix [SME 3022]
178    
179  * Wed Aug 15 2012 JP Pialasse <test@pialasse.com> 1.3-2.sme  * Wed Aug 15 2012 Jean-Philippe Pialasse <tests@pialasse.com> 1.3-2.sme
180  - 64 bits [SME 7040]  - 64 bits [SME 7040]
181    
182  * Sun Jun 10 2012 JP Pialasse <test@pialasse.com> 1.3-1.sme  * Sun Jun 10 2012 Jean-Philippe Pialasse <tests@pialasse.com> 1.3-1.sme
183  - Initial version  - Initial version
184    
185  %description  %description
# Line 150  This contrib is a bit inspired by e-smit Line 196  This contrib is a bit inspired by e-smit
196    
197  %prep  %prep
198  %setup  %setup
199    %patch0 -p1
200    %patch1 -p1
201    %patch2 -p1
202    %patch3 -p1
203    %patch4 -p1
204    %patch5 -p1
205    %patch6 -p1
206    %patch7 -p1
207    %patch8 -p1
208    
209  %build  %build
210  perl createlinks  perl createlinks
# Line 168  rm -rf $RPM_BUILD_ROOT Line 223  rm -rf $RPM_BUILD_ROOT
223  (cd root   ; find . -depth -print | cpio -dump $RPM_BUILD_ROOT)  (cd root   ; find . -depth -print | cpio -dump $RPM_BUILD_ROOT)
224  rm -f %{name}-%{version}-filelist  rm -f %{name}-%{version}-filelist
225  /sbin/e-smith/genfilelist $RPM_BUILD_ROOT \  /sbin/e-smith/genfilelist $RPM_BUILD_ROOT \
226  |grep -v '/etc/e-smith/sql/init/smeadmin'\  --file /usr/bin/smeadmind 'attr(755,root,root)' \
227  |grep -v '/usr/bin/smeadmind'\  --file /usr/share/doc/smeserver-smeadmin/add_ds_to_rrd.pl 'attr(755,root,root)' \
228  |grep -v '/usr/share/doc/smeserver-smeadmin/add_ds_to_rrd.pl'> %{name}-%{version}-filelist   > %{name}-%{version}-filelist
229    
230  %clean  %clean
231  rm -rf $RPM_BUILD_ROOT  rm -rf $RPM_BUILD_ROOT
# Line 179  rm -rf $RPM_BUILD_ROOT Line 234  rm -rf $RPM_BUILD_ROOT
234    
235  %preun  %preun
236    
   
237  %post  %post
238    
239  %postun  %postun
240    
241  %files -f %{name}-%{version}-filelist  %files -f %{name}-%{version}-filelist
242  %defattr(-,root,root)  %defattr(-,root,root)
 %attr(755,root,root) /etc/e-smith/sql/init/smeadmin  
 %attr(755,root,root) /usr/bin/smeadmind  
 %attr(755,root,root) /usr/share/doc/smeserver-smeadmin/add_ds_to_rrd.pl  


Legend:
Removed lines/characters  
Changed lines/characters
  Added lines/characters

admin@koozali.org
ViewVC Help
Powered by ViewVC 1.2.1 RSS 2.0 feed